FileDocCategorySizeDatePackage
AEProxyAddressMapper.javaAPI DocAzureus 3.0.3.41655Thu Feb 09 19:42:44 GMT 2006com.aelitis.azureus.core.proxy

AEProxyAddressMapper

public interface AEProxyAddressMapper
author
parg

Fields Summary
Constructors Summary
Methods Summary
public java.lang.Stringexternalise(java.lang.String address)

public java.net.URLexternalise(java.net.URL url)

public java.lang.Stringinternalise(java.lang.String address)
SOCKS 5 is limited to 255 char DNS names. So for longer ones (e.g. I2P 'names') we have to replace then with somethin shorter to get through the SOCKS layer and then remap them on the otherside. These functions are only active if a SOCKS proxy is enabled and looping back (in process is the assumption)

param
address
return

public java.net.URLinternalise(java.net.URL url)